Why This “Lure” Works

All right, it is not a lure – but your lures and baits only work properly if the plumbing is sorted. The black nickel three-prong connector T swivel is basically a compact three-way swivel with a T-shaped body and three connection points. One eye takes the main line, one takes the business end (hook, lure or rig section), and the third handles your sinker or extra dropper. Because each arm can pivot, it stops everything twisting around on itself when current, wind and fish start pulling in different directions.

The “black nickel” bit is important. A lot of these three-prong connector T-swivels are made from brass or other metal and then plated with black nickel, so they are tougher against corrosion and less flashy than bright chrome hardware. That darker finish blends in better in clear water and under bright light, so fish see the bait rather than a shiny lump of metal above it. The three-prong layout also spreads stress out more evenly than trying to bodge extra leaders onto a single barrel swivel, which is why proper three-way swivels are so popular for deep and current-heavy rigs.

How To Fish It

You never fish a black nickel three-prong connector T swivel on its own – you build rigs around it. The classic move is the standard three-way rig that Bass Pro, Catfish Edge and pretty much every “rigging 101” guide bangs on about. The idea is simple: one branch for the weight, one branch for the bait, and the main line coming in from the top so the whole lot stays neat in the current.

To build a basic bottom three-way rig with a black nickel three-prong connector T swivel:

  • Tie your main line to the top eye of the T swivel.
  • Clip or tie a short dropper (20–30 cm) with a sinker to one side eye.
  • On the remaining eye, tie a longer leader (60–120 cm) with your hook or lure.

When you drop that rig down, the weight keeps you pinned near the bottom while the bait leader swings just off the deck. That is exactly how three-way rigs are described in classic bottom-rig articles and tutorials – short leg for the lead, longer leg for the bait, all meeting at a tough three-way swivel. Your black nickel three-prong connector T swivel is just a compact version of that system.

For catfish or big river species, you can run heavier line and weights, but the principle is identical. Catfish Edge, TakeMeFishing and other rigging resources all recommend tying the three-way swivel to your main line, then running separate leaders to the sinker and hook so they do not tangle. The beauty of using a three-prong connector T swivel with snaps is that you can unclip and change sinker size or leader length without rebuilding the whole rig from scratch.

You can also use a black nickel three-prong connector T swivel as a simple sub-line splitter for troll or drift setups. Run the main line into the top, a weight or diver off one arm, and a lure leader from the other. That lets you keep a crankbait, spoon or soft plastic hovering above the weight while the boat covers water – very similar to the lake-trout three-way trolling rigs that Bass Pro and other big names showcase for deep structure work.

When To Use It

The black nickel three-prong connector T swivel is a problem-solver for when conditions or your plan make basic two-point rigs annoying. Any time you are fishing with current, depth or multiple baits, a three-prong connector earns its place in the chain. Medium to strong river flow? A three-way rig with a pyramid or bell sinker on the short leg helps keep your bait parked in the strike zone instead of rolling all over the place.

In tidal estuaries, channels and surf, a three-way rig based on a black nickel three-prong connector T swivel helps keep the sinker doing its job while your bait flutters just above snags. Rough-ground specialists love three-way swivels for this very reason – you can adjust dropper and leader lengths to ride over rock and rubble while still presenting something natural where fish actually live.

In stillwaters and big lakes, these connectors show their worth when you want to run more than one bait height from the same main line, or when you are slow-trolling a lure behind a controlled weight. You can put one bait low and one a bit higher, or mix a livebait on one leg with a plastic or spoon on the other, and let the black nickel three-prong connector T swivel keep the traffic under control instead of tangling into a chandelier after five minutes.

Gear Pairing

Because this is a piece of terminal tackle, the gear pairing is more about matching line and swivel size than picking one exact rod and reel. For general freshwater work – bass, walleye, smaller cats, perch – a 7 ft medium or medium-heavy spinning or casting rod with 10–20 lb mono or 15–30 lb braid is a sweet spot. The black nickel three-prong connector T swivel simply becomes the hub in the middle of your leader and sinker system.

For heavier targets (proper catfish, pike, inshore saltwater predators), step up to 30–50 lb braid and suitably chunky leaders, then choose a black nickel three-prong connector T swivel that is clearly rated to cope with that sort of load. The swivel should always be stronger than your weakest leader so that if something has to go, it is the hook leader or the weight dropper, not the connector itself.
